locality in which the accident

book pince.

Mr. Le pointed out that accord- ing to one of the photography one section of Pokfulum Road was littered with rubbish and he nak ed the photographer whether he could say that rubbish, was there at the time of the accident.

Inspector Alexander said that if information, was required on that point he could produce a Chinese constable who was on duty on that! spot on June 1, 1925.

Coolle's Evidence.

A Chinese coolie of no fixed abode said that he was one of the five men who were injured, that night. They were sleeping op posite the junction of Pokfulum Road and Queen's Road Wost. At about 10.30 pm. motor car No. 1249 ran into them. Witness was relled over by the car which hurt
